The U.S. Federal Communications Commission (FCC) said on
Monday that it was banning the import of new, foreign-made consumer
routers, citing "unacceptable" risks to cyber and national
security. The action was designed to safeguard Americans and the
underlying communications networks the country relies on, FCC
Chairman Brendan Carr said in a post on X. The development means
